Specifications

The 3M Vortemp Heating Assy PK1 V-200, Pack is designed to integrate with 3M’s supplied air systems, specifically for providing conditioned air to respiratory protection. The core function is to deliver regulated, warm air, with the capability to increase air temperature by as much as 28°C (50°F) above ambient conditions. This is achieved through a heating element and an airflow regulation mechanism. The unit connects via a standard breathing hose (though hose 67100-608 is specifically mentioned for both powered and supplied air systems), ensuring compatibility within the 3M ecosystem. The assembly itself is belt-mounted via the 56221-400 assembly, which includes the motor/blower, battery pack, charger, and other necessary components. While the assembly provides the powered air, the Vortemp heating assembly is the component that conditions this air for temperature. The “PK1 V-200, Pack” designation suggests it’s a package containing the heating assembly, likely for a single user or a small setup, with “V-200” being the specific model number for the heating unit and “Pack” denoting its retail configuration. This feature of precisely controlled temperature delivery is critical for applications requiring prolonged wear of respiratory protection in environments that might otherwise be uncomfortably cool, preventing heat loss and enhancing wearer comfort significantly.

Accessories and Customization Options

As the 3M Vortemp Heating Assy PK1 V-200, Pack is an assembly designed to integrate into a larger respiratory protection system, its primary “accessories” are the components of that system. The product description highlights the need for a breathing hose (67100-608) and a belt-mounted assembly for the powered air supply (56221-400), which includes the motor/blower, battery pack, charger, and flow meter. The heating assembly itself is not typically customized; rather, it’s selected based on the user’s specific needs within the broader 3M product line. Its purpose is to add a specific environmental conditioning function—warm air—to an existing PAPR setup. Therefore, customization is less about modifying the heating unit and more about selecting the correct combination of headgear, breathing hose, and air supply unit that best fits the work environment and required protection level.
